me and my pop have been to every 360 nationals since 2000. The race used to be held on fathers day weekend in June. They woul dhave about 90 cars and only about 3k people. Since the race has been moved to kick off southern Iowa Sprintweek the car count has risen to ......I think it was 137 last year....and there were at least 10k there on sat. night.
I can't imagine there is THAT MUCH difference in the quality of racing between both nationals. We love it because you see what I really think is THE BEST race of the year........and do not have to deal with as many people as the next weekend. The only race that maybe could rival it is the Short Track Nationals in Little Rock.....but I'll have to wait until October to be able to comment on that. What makes the 360 nationals even better I think is that on saturday they can only take the top 106 in points to run features, because they run a weekly 410 show that night......so you have about 160 sprints on that 1 night alone.........last I checked the 410 Nationals didn't boast that. But I imagine the atmosphere is more in every way for the 410's. But whereas it's great to see the best sprint drivers in the world.......man it's just as good to see the best 360 drivers in the world.......and like I said......not have to deal with people.
